Project Manager

Project Manager

Operational Responsibilities
• Own project delivery end-to-end including planning, scheduling, site execution, and resource coordination; conduct weekly look-ahead meetings and daily task tracking.
• Hold functional responsibility for the teams allocated to sites under their care.
• Ensure that all resources under his site responsibilities are efficient and effective ensuring high safe productivity across all sites, including the adequate management of rotation and movement of personnel between sites
• Ensure overtime is distributed, justified and classified under billable to clients, rework activities or warranty claims
• Ensure that all DLI obligations as per project contract are being met.
• Ensure that all Supplier and service contract obligations as per contract are being met
• Manage Client Relationships and ensure continuous communication with client to assure client satisfaction
• Chair Kick off meetings and project meetings with all stakeholders - both externally and internally.

Administrative Responsibilities
• Create, Maintain, monitor and update project folders (Project Plans and Resource plans - both planned and actual, RFIs, drawings, procurement); issue variation claims and payment applications; ensure inspection permits and compliance logs are tracked.
• Follow and record variations and extra works in line with works being executed, variation to BOQ impacting workflows and extra works. This is to be supported in writing with client representative. This includes:
a) Monthly interim claims across all sites
b) Claims to cover:
1) progress claims as per BOQ
2) variations to BOQ during the course of works.
3) Extra works quoted separately consisting of extra works and/or variations to BOQ resulting in change in task flows according to agreed Work Planner

Quality Responsibilities
• Conduct formal site audits; ensure availability of tools, PPE, and testing equipment; manage site quality standards and lessons-learned reviews.
• Act as the quality management representative as and when required for projects not under his/her responsibility
• Carry out QHSE Inspections as and when required
• Manage customer relationship and customer complaints

HSE Responsibilities
• Ensure compliance with HSE standards; report and resolve incidents and near-misses with corrective actions within 48 hours.
• Act as the HSE Management representative as and when required for projects not under his/her responsibility
• Carry out QHSE Inspections as and when required

Asset Responsibilities
• Verify and confirm tools and calibrated testing equipment are prepared 48 hours before work fronts open.

Financial Responsibilities
• Approve labour allocation and overtime; lead cost control; manage payment applications and ensure budgets are not exceeded.
• Ensure that all supporting documentation is present and forwarded for invoicing. This includes:

Reporting Responsibilities
• Prepare weekly executive dashboard; maintain dashboards and issue progress reports and minutes to clients within 24 hours of meetings.

Attitude & Culture Responsibilities
• Motivate and mentor Site Supervisors; enforce company behaviour standards and resolve site issues fairly.

Training Responsibilities
• Conduct quarterly performance reviews of Supervisors; organise lessons-learnt sessions; coach site teams aligned with project KPIs.
